New paper offers tree interpretation of dependency parsing

A new paper proposes a tree-based interpretation of arc-standard dependency derivations in natural language processing. This interpretation views these derivations as the incremental construction of lexicalized ordered trees with contiguous yields. The research demonstrates that this representation is unique to projective dependency trees and offers a new perspective on arc-standard parsing by implicitly constructing constituency-style ordered trees.
